Donald Trump's presidential campaign might spell doom for his Celebrity Apprentice gig


Donald Trump's just-announced presidential campaign may spell doom for his other job: the host of NBC's long-running reality series Celebrity Apprentice, which — yes, really! — is still on TV, with its 15th season on the way.
Following Trump's announcement, NBC indicated that Trump's presidential aspirations may mark the end of his tenure as a reality show icon. "We will re-evaluate Trump's role as host of Celebrity Apprentice should it become necessary, as we are committed to this franchise," the network said in a statement.
Of course, losing Trump doesn't necessarily mean the end of Celebrity Apprentice — it just means the series will need a new host. What's Omarosa doing these days, anyway?
